@@ -7,6 +7,13 @@ services:
77 GENESIS_TIMESTAMP : ${GENESIS_TIMESTAMP:-}
88 GENESIS_MIX_HASH : ${GENESIS_MIX_HASH:-}
99 RPC_GAS_CAP : ${RPC_GAS_CAP:-500000000}
10+ CACHE_SIZE : ${GETH_CACHE_SIZE:-25000}
11+ ENABLE_PREIMAGES : ${ENABLE_PREIMAGES:-true}
12+ GC_MODE : ${GC_MODE:-full}
13+ STATE_HISTORY : ${STATE_HISTORY:-100000}
14+ TX_HISTORY : ${TX_HISTORY:-100000}
15+ CACHE_GC : ${CACHE_GC:-25}
16+ CACHE_TRIE : ${CACHE_TRIE:-15}
1017 volumes :
1118 - geth-data:/root/ethereum
1219 ports :
@@ -30,18 +37,17 @@ services:
3037 L1_PREFETCH_FORWARD : ${L1_PREFETCH_FORWARD:-200}
3138 L1_PREFETCH_THREADS : ${L1_PREFETCH_THREADS:-10}
3239 VALIDATION_ENABLED : ${VALIDATION_ENABLED:-false}
33- JOB_CONCURRENCY : ${JOB_CONCURRENCY:-2 }
34- STORAGE_VERIFICATION_THREADS : ${STORAGE_VERIFICATION_THREADS:-10 }
40+ JOB_CONCURRENCY : ${JOB_CONCURRENCY:-6 }
41+ JOB_THREADS : ${JOB_THREADS:-3 }
3542 PROFILE_IMPORT : ${PROFILE_IMPORT:-true}
3643 ETHSCRIPTIONS_API_BASE_URL : ${ETHSCRIPTIONS_API_BASE_URL-''}
3744 # Transient validation error handling configuration
38- VALIDATION_TRANSIENT_RETRIES : ${VALIDATION_TRANSIENT_RETRIES:-3 }
39- VALIDATION_RETRY_WAIT_SECONDS : ${VALIDATION_RETRY_WAIT_SECONDS:-2 }
40- ETHSCRIPTIONS_API_RETRIES : ${ETHSCRIPTIONS_API_RETRIES:-3 }
45+ VALIDATION_TRANSIENT_RETRIES : ${VALIDATION_TRANSIENT_RETRIES:-1000 }
46+ VALIDATION_RETRY_WAIT_SECONDS : ${VALIDATION_RETRY_WAIT_SECONDS:-5 }
47+ ETHSCRIPTIONS_API_RETRIES : ${ETHSCRIPTIONS_API_RETRIES:-7 }
4148 # Validation lag control
4249 VALIDATION_LAG_HARD_LIMIT : ${VALIDATION_LAG_HARD_LIMIT:-30}
4350 ETHSCRIPTIONS_API_KEY : ${ETHSCRIPTIONS_API_KEY:-}
44- DEBUG : 0
4551 volumes :
4652 - node-storage:/rails/storage
4753 depends_on :
0 commit comments